Webb16 apr. 2024 · Open "Programs and Features". On the left, click on "Turn Windows features on or off". In the list scroll down to "SMB 1.0/CIFS File Sharing Support" and make sure all three items have a checkbox next to them and click OK. If these were unchecked, you will most likely have to reboot after installing these. WebbShared folders are supported with Windows 2000 or later, Linux, and Oracle Solaris guests. Oracle VM VirtualBox includes experimental support for Mac OS X and OS/2 guests. Shared folders physically reside on the host and are then shared with the guest, which uses a special file system driver in the Guest Additions to talk to the host.

Setuid权限:通过Setuid权限,普通用户可以在执行某些特定程序时,拥 … highmount body warmerWebbShared libraries, .DLL in windows, .dylib in OSX and .so in Linux, are loaded at runtime. That means that the application executable needs to know where are the required shared libraries when it runs.
